スマートコントラクトで実現する暗号資産 (仮想通貨)の未来



スマートコントラクトで実現する暗号資産 (仮想通貨)の未来


スマートコントラクトで実現する暗号資産 (仮想通貨)の未来

はじめに

暗号資産(仮想通貨)は、その誕生以来、金融システムに大きな変革をもたらす可能性を秘めてきました。当初は投機的な資産としての側面が強調されていましたが、技術の進歩とともに、その応用範囲は金融分野にとどまらず、様々な産業へと拡大しつつあります。その中でも、スマートコントラクトは、暗号資産の可能性を最大限に引き出すための重要な要素として注目されています。本稿では、スマートコントラクトの基礎から、暗号資産における応用事例、そして将来展望について、詳細に解説します。

スマートコントラクトとは

スマートコントラクトは、ブロックチェーン上で実行される自己実行型の契約です。従来の契約は、当事者間の合意に基づき、法的機関や仲介者を介して履行されますが、スマートコントラクトは、事前に定義された条件が満たされた場合に、自動的に契約内容を実行します。この自動実行機能により、仲介者による介入を排除し、取引コストの削減、透明性の向上、そして契約の信頼性向上を実現します。

スマートコントラクトの基本的な構成要素は以下の通りです。

* **契約当事者:** スマートコントラクトに関与する主体。
* **契約条件:** 契約の履行条件を定義するルール。
* **契約内容:** 契約条件が満たされた場合に実行される処理。
* **データ:** 契約の実行に必要な情報。

スマートコントラクトは、プログラミング言語を用いて記述され、ブロックチェーン上にデプロイされます。一度デプロイされたスマートコントラクトは、改ざんが困難であり、その実行結果は公開台帳に記録されるため、高い信頼性を確保できます。

暗号資産におけるスマートコントラクトの応用

スマートコントラクトは、暗号資産の様々な分野で応用されています。以下に代表的な事例を紹介します。

分散型金融 (DeFi)

DeFiは、従来の金融サービスをブロックチェーン上で実現する概念です。スマートコントラクトは、DeFiアプリケーションの中核を担っており、貸付、借入、取引、保険など、様々な金融サービスを仲介者なしで提供することを可能にします。

* **分散型取引所 (DEX):** スマートコントラクトを用いて、ユーザー同士が直接暗号資産を取引できるプラットフォーム。
* **レンディングプラットフォーム:** スマートコントラクトを用いて、暗号資産の貸し手と借り手をマッチングさせるプラットフォーム。
* **ステーブルコイン:** 法定通貨などの資産に裏付けられた価値を持つ暗号資産。スマートコントラクトを用いて、その価値の安定性を維持。

トークン化

トークン化とは、現実世界の資産を暗号資産として表現する技術です。不動産、株式、債券、美術品など、様々な資産をトークン化することで、流動性の向上、取引コストの削減、そして投資機会の拡大を実現します。スマートコントラクトは、トークンの発行、管理、そして取引を安全かつ効率的に行うために不可欠な要素です。

サプライチェーン管理

スマートコントラクトは、サプライチェーンの透明性と効率性を向上させるために活用できます。商品の製造から配送までの過程をブロックチェーン上に記録し、スマートコントラクトを用いて、各段階の条件が満たされた場合に、自動的に支払いや商品の移動を実行します。これにより、偽造品の排除、トレーサビリティの向上、そしてサプライチェーン全体の最適化を実現します。

投票システム

スマートコントラクトは、安全で透明性の高い投票システムを構築するために利用できます。投票者の身元を匿名化し、投票結果を改ざんから保護することで、公正な選挙を実現します。ブロックチェーン上に投票結果を記録することで、透明性を確保し、不正行為を防止します。

デジタル著作権管理 (DRM)

スマートコントラクトは、デジタルコンテンツの著作権を保護するために活用できます。コンテンツの作成者と利用者の間でスマートコントラクトを締結し、利用条件を定義することで、不正なコピーや配布を防止します。コンテンツの利用状況を追跡し、著作権者に適切な報酬を支払うことも可能です。

スマートコントラクトの課題と今後の展望

スマートコントラクトは、多くの可能性を秘めている一方で、いくつかの課題も抱えています。

セキュリティリスク

スマートコントラクトは、一度デプロイされると改ざんが困難であるため、コードに脆弱性があると、ハッキングの標的となる可能性があります。スマートコントラクトの開発には、高度なセキュリティ知識が必要であり、厳格なテストと監査が不可欠です。

スケーラビリティ問題

ブロックチェーンのスケーラビリティ問題は、スマートコントラクトの実行速度や取引手数料に影響を与えます。ブロックチェーンのスケーラビリティを向上させるための様々な技術が開発されており、今後の進展が期待されます。

法的規制

スマートコントラクトは、従来の法的枠組みに適合しない場合があり、法的規制の整備が遅れているのが現状です。スマートコントラクトの法的地位や責任の所在など、明確化すべき課題が多く存在します。

しかしながら、これらの課題を克服するための技術開発や法整備が進められており、スマートコントラクトの将来は明るいと言えるでしょう。特に、以下の分野での進展が期待されます。

* **形式検証:** スマートコントラクトのコードが正しく動作することを数学的に証明する技術。
* **レイヤー2ソリューション:** ブロックチェーンのスケーラビリティ問題を解決するための技術。
* **相互運用性:** 異なるブロックチェーン間でスマートコントラクトを連携させる技術。
* **プライバシー保護:** スマートコントラクトの実行内容を秘匿するための技術。

これらの技術の進歩により、スマートコントラクトは、より安全で効率的、そして汎用性の高いものとなり、暗号資産の可能性をさらに拡大していくでしょう。

結論

スマートコントラクトは、暗号資産の未来を形作るための重要な要素です。その自動実行機能、透明性、そして信頼性により、金融分野にとどまらず、様々な産業に変革をもたらす可能性を秘めています。セキュリティリスク、スケーラビリティ問題、そして法的規制といった課題は存在するものの、技術開発や法整備が進められており、スマートコントラクトの将来は明るいと言えるでしょう。今後、スマートコントラクトがどのように進化し、私たちの社会にどのような影響を与えるのか、注目していく必要があります。


前の記事

暗号資産 (仮想通貨)トレード初心者におすすめの戦術選

次の記事

メタマスク使い方講座!簡単セットアップガイド

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です